What is compostable packaging in 2027?<\/h3>\nCompostable packaging in 2027 refers to materials certified to break down into non-toxic biomass within 90-180 days (industrial composting) or 6-12 months (home composting) under specific conditions, verified by third-party standards (BPI, TUV Austria, EN 13432). Unlike 2020s-era compostables limited to simple applications, 2027 materials include next-generation biopolymers (PHA, cellulose nanofibers, seaweed polymers) achieving performance parity with petroleum plastics\u2014heat tolerance to 250\u00b0F, 12-month shelf stability, superior barrier properties. Key advancements: widespread home compostability (90%+ population accessibility), cost premiums reduced to 10-25% (approaching parity), and regulatory mandates making compostable packaging the default across foodservice and retail sectors.\n<h3 style=\"margin-top:40px;margin-bottom:20px;font-size:24px;font-weight:600;color:#1a1a1a;line-height:1.4;\">2. What materials are used in compostable packaging?<\/h3>\n2027 compostable packaging utilizes advanced biopolymers and bio-based coatings: (1) PHA from bacterial fermentation (home compostable, 220\u00b0F heat tolerance), (2) Cellulose nanofibers from wood pulp (250\u00b0F tolerance, superior strength), (3) Lignin polymers from paper industry waste (240\u00b0F, lowest cost premium), (4) Seaweed-based films (ocean-farmed, 2-4 month home composting), (5) Mycelium composites from fungal structures (custom-grown protective packaging), and (6) Next-gen coatings including enzymatic barriers, nanocellulose films, and chitosan from seafood waste. These materials replace first-generation PLA (limited to 185\u00b0F) and achieve 85-95% performance parity with petroleum plastics while maintaining full compostability certifications.\n<h3 style=\"margin-top:40px;margin-bottom:20px;font-size:24px;font-weight:600;color:#1a1a1a;line-height:1.4;\">3. Is compostable packaging really better for the environment?<\/h3>\nYes, when properly disposed of, certified compostable packaging delivers measurable environmental benefits: (1) Diverts 75-90% of waste from landfills (breaks down into nutrient-rich soil vs persisting 500+ years), (2) Reduces carbon footprint 30-65% vs petroleum plastics (renewable feedstocks, lower processing emissions), (3) Eliminates toxic microplastics (complete biodegradation to organic matter), and (4) Utilizes waste streams (agricultural byproducts, forestry waste) vs virgin petroleum. Critical caveat: benefits require proper disposal\u2014compostables in landfills don&#8217;t break down properly (anaerobic conditions), and contaminating recycling streams creates problems. 2027 infrastructure improvements (65% population composting access, home-compostable certifications) significantly improve proper disposal rates from 35% (2023) to projected 68% (2027).\n<h3 style=\"margin-top:40px;margin-bottom:20px;font-size:24px;font-weight:600;color:#1a1a1a;line-height:1.4;\">5.
